Unfortunately, the arithmetic is not good. We like to think a Ceasar salad, for example, is healthy because lettuce. If you actually calculate all the calories from the toppings, however, the lettuce ends up being like 50 calories out of 470. The rest is refined fat with sugar and salt and flavoring. Yummy but hard on health.
Unfortunately, we're wired for potency and refined foods give us potency much higher than nature gives by combining sugar, fat and salt. Dressings are notorious for it.
